The art without date of expiry was again manifested in Jerez de la Frontera with a Morante of sublime Puebla, who chiseled a task of epoch to cut the maximum trophies and surrender to the square with the unrepeatable magic of his crutch. His inspiration was found with ‘Negro’, a bull of Álvaro Núñez who rammed with class and rhythm and who deserved the return to the arena.
